
oMLX
Mac LLM server that cuts agent wait times from 90s to 5s

oMLX turns your Mac into a full LLM inference server, run from the menu bar. It serves text, vision, OCR, embedding and reranker models with continuous batching, plus a RAM+SSD tiered KV cache that survives restarts, so Claude Code and Cursor respond in about 5s instead of 90s. OpenAI and Anthropic compatible APIs drop straight in. Native Swift, not Electron. Apache 2.0, open source.

Medium. Direct competitors: 1. Ollama (ollama.com), 2. LM Studio (lmstudio.ai), 3. LocalAI (localai.io), 4. llama.cpp tools, 5. MLX examples on GitHub. Advantages: Superior Mac-native speed via MLX, unique persistent tiered KV cache, menu-bar simplicity, and dramatic agent latency reduction; OpenAI/Anthropic API compatibility. Disadvantages: Mac-only (vs cross-platform competitors), lacks some enterprise features or broad model support of Ollama. Strong differentiation in performance for Apple ecosystem users.
